Details
-
Type:
RFC
-
Status: Adopted
-
Resolution: Unresolved
-
Component/s: LSST
-
Labels:None
Description
In order to properly include in the product tree all packages resolved via lsst_distrib, it is necessary to provide the following information, in each package git repository:
- Short name of the package, a text to display in the (yellow box) of the product tree (max 18 characters)
- Suggestion: It could follow the namespace naming rules, but first letter capital
- Key string, 2 to 7 character, it shall be unique, the shorter the better, it has to be used for automatic process building the product tree
- Examples, JCAL for jointcal, ASTMT for astro_metadata_translator, DAFB for daf_butler,
- Reference person(s), someone that has the best knowledge on that software package and is usually maintaining it, 2 references can be given
- Proposed format: github_username (Full Name) [github_username (Full Name)]
The proposal is to add this information in a file, my first thought is a info.yaml in the home folder of each repository.
Attachments
Issue Links
Activity
Description |
In order to properly include in the product tree all packages resolved via lsst_distrib, it is necessary to provide the following information, in each package git repository:
* Short name of the package, a text to display in the (yellow box) of the product tree (max 18 characters) * Suggestion: It could follow the namespace naming rules, but first letter capital * Key string, 2 to 7 character, it shall be unique, the shorter the better, it has to be used for automatic process building the product tree * Examples, JCAL for jointcal, ASTMT for astro_metadata_translator, DAFB for daf_butler, * Reference person, someone that has the best knowledge on that software package and is usually maintaining it * Proposed format: github_username (Full Name) The proposal is to add this information in a file, my first thought is a info.yaml in the home folder of each repository. |
In order to properly include in the product tree all packages resolved via lsst_distrib, it is necessary to provide the following information, in each package git repository:
* Short name of the package, a text to display in the (yellow box) of the product tree (max 18 characters) * Suggestion: It could follow the namespace naming rules, but first letter capital * Key string, 2 to 7 character, it shall be unique, the shorter the better, it has to be used for automatic process building the product tree * Examples, JCAL for jointcal, ASTMT for astro_metadata_translator, DAFB for daf_butler, * Reference person(s), someone that has the best knowledge on that software package and is usually maintaining it * Proposed format: github_username (Full Name) The proposal is to add this information in a file, my first thought is a info.yaml in the home folder of each repository. |
Description |
In order to properly include in the product tree all packages resolved via lsst_distrib, it is necessary to provide the following information, in each package git repository:
* Short name of the package, a text to display in the (yellow box) of the product tree (max 18 characters) * Suggestion: It could follow the namespace naming rules, but first letter capital * Key string, 2 to 7 character, it shall be unique, the shorter the better, it has to be used for automatic process building the product tree * Examples, JCAL for jointcal, ASTMT for astro_metadata_translator, DAFB for daf_butler, * Reference person(s), someone that has the best knowledge on that software package and is usually maintaining it * Proposed format: github_username (Full Name) The proposal is to add this information in a file, my first thought is a info.yaml in the home folder of each repository. |
In order to properly include in the product tree all packages resolved via lsst_distrib, it is necessary to provide the following information, in each package git repository:
* Short name of the package, a text to display in the (yellow box) of the product tree (max 18 characters) ** Suggestion: It could follow the namespace naming rules, but first letter capital * Key string, 2 to 7 character, it shall be unique, the shorter the better, it has to be used for automatic process building the product tree ** Examples, JCAL for jointcal, ASTMT for astro_metadata_translator, DAFB for daf_butler, * Reference person(s), someone that has the best knowledge on that software package and is usually maintaining it, 2 references can be given ** Proposed format: github_username (Full Name) [github_username (Full Name)] The proposal is to add this information in a file, my first thought is a info.yaml in the home folder of each repository. |
Planned End | 10/Dec/18 6:52 PM | 13/Dec/18 6:52 PM |
Remote Link | This issue links to "Page (Confluence)" [ 19570 ] |
Remote Link | This issue links to "Page (Confluence)" [ 19592 ] |
Status | Proposed [ 10805 ] | Adopted [ 10806 ] |
Remote Link | This issue links to "Page (Confluence)" [ 19652 ] |
Assignee | Gabriele Comoretto [ gcomoretto ] | Kian-Tat Lim [ ktl ] |
Remote Link | This issue links to "Page (Confluence)" [ 27441 ] |